Dual Diagnosis Disorders: What Are They?

Dual-diagnosis disorders, also known as co-occurring disorders,  occur when an individual faces mental health and addiction issues simultaneously. This dual challenge requires integrated treatment approaches to address both conditions effectively. For instance, someone with anxiety and substance use disorder would benefit from a treatment plan that tackles both issues together. 

Addressing a dual diagnosis includes both mental health and addiction treatment. Integrated treatment programs are created to provide quality care, helping you manage your symptoms and work toward recovery from both mental health issues and addiction. Effective treatment addresses the symptoms of each condition and helps improve overall well-being and quality of life.

Does Health Insurance Cover Dual Diagnosis Treatment in Tennessee?

Yes, many private health insurance plans do cover dual diagnosis rehab treatment in Tennessee. This includes integrated care for co-occurring mental health and substance use disorders. The level of dual diagnosis treatment coverage depends on your specific provider, plan type, and in-network options available through facilities like Freeman Recovery Center.

When exploring insurance coverage for dual diagnosis treatment, it’s important to review your plan’s behavioral health benefits, check for exclusions, and confirm if your policy includes mental health parity protections. Some insurance carriers offer umbrella policies that further support coverage for co-occurring disorders.     Do Health Insurance Providers Fully Cover Dual Diagnosis Treatment?

    Many insurance plans, especially those compliant with the Affordable Care Act (ACA), offer coverage for dual diagnosis treatment as part of their mental health and substance use disorder benefits. The specifics, like premiums, deductibles, and coverage limits, will vary from one plan to the next. It’s important to review your policy details to understand the benefits for dual diagnosis treatment.

    Coverage typically includes various types of dual diagnosis interventions and therapies, but your deductible and copayments can impact costs.     Why does dual diagnosis treatment sometimes have different coverage than standard rehab?

    Why does dual diagnosis treatment sometimes have different coverage than standard rehab?

    Dual diagnosis care addresses both substance use and a co-occurring mental health condition simultaneously, which means it touches both the behavioral health and substance use benefits on your insurance plan. Some plans authorize them as a combined benefit, others split them — your verification will spell that out, including whether psychiatric services and medication management fall under separate coverage tiers.

    Will my insurance require a separate authorization for the mental health portion?

    Will my insurance require a separate authorization for the mental health portion?

    Often, yes. Many plans require prior authorization for the substance use level of care (like residential or PHP) and a separate clinical review for psychiatric services or psychotropic medications. Freeman’s admissions team handles both authorizations on your behalf so nothing gets delayed.

    What if my plan covers substance use treatment but limits mental health benefits?

    What if my plan covers substance use treatment but limits mental health benefits?

    Federal parity law generally prevents insurers from offering weaker mental health coverage than medical/surgical coverage — but plan structures vary. If your plan has session limits, daily caps, or prior auth requirements that seem restrictive, the admissions team can review your specific benefits and identify any gaps before treatment starts.

    Does dual diagnosis treatment cost more out of pocket than standard rehab?

    Does dual diagnosis treatment cost more out of pocket than standard rehab?

    Not usually. Because parity laws require equivalent coverage, the cost structure is typically the same as for standard substance use treatment — you’ll have the same deductible, coinsurance, and out-of-pocket maximum applied. The combined nature of the care is built into how the program is billed.
